Tinubu Backtracks on NTA DG Appointment, Reinstates Former DG

President Bola Tinubu has ordered the recall of Salihu Dembos as the Director-General of the Nigerian Television Authority (NTA) following recent management changes at the agency.

According to a statement from Bayo Onanuga, the Presidential spokesman, Tinubu’s directive reverses the recent appointment of Rotimi Pedro as NTA DG.

Dembos, who was appointed to the position by President Tinubu in October 2023, will now return to complete his three-year term.

In a similar move, the President also directed the recall of Ayo Adewuyi, the Executive Director of News, to complete his tenure, which ends in 2027.

‎Adewuyi was appointed by President Tinubu in 2024.

‎The directive effectively overrides earlier appointments of a new Director-General, Executive Director of News, Executive Director of Marketing, and Managing Director of NTA Enterprises.
